WebNov 25, 2024 · From Lent (and even Carnival, or Apokries) to Easter, the Greek calendar is filled with traditions and rituals that many Greeks still observe. Kicking things off, the Thursday of the second week of Carnival is known as Tsiknopempti, or Burnt Thursday. Greeks traditionally get together and grill meat on this day. WebThe most important festivals are: • Ifestia Festival The Ifestia Festival (translating into the Greek Volcano festival) is organized annually in Santorini every August. It features a representation of the volcanic eruption with fireworks and a series of stimulating events, concerts, and dance performances. • International Music Festival

WebOct 21, 2024 · The practice of celebrating annual cyclical festivals is an ancient Egyptian tradition that was present throughout history passing by the Graeco-roman period, Christianity and finally Islam ... dancing stick figure artistJanuary 1st is the Feast of Agios Vassilis (the Santa Claus in Greece is Saint Basil), celebrated with church services. That day, all Greek families cut the vasilopita, a sweet bread with a coin inside which brings good luck for the year to come to its finder.
